Movie Review – Despicable Me 2

Read Time:35 Second

DespicableMe2Universal’s Despicable Me 2 is as funny and charming as the first movie.

Gru has become a nice guy and content to care for the girls, but throw in a possible love interest — Lucy, voiced by Kristen Wiig — and Gru’s life begins to change.

We get to see more of the Minions, which is great, because they provided most of the funny moments. I will tell you that the musical number they perform at the end of the movie is worth the price of admission. I heard plenty of laughter from both children and parents in the theater.
